Detailed Description
The preferred embodiments of the present invention will be described in conjunction with the accompanying drawings, and it will be understood that they are presented herein only to illustrate and explain the present invention, and not to limit the present invention.
Examples
As shown in fig. 1-2, the utility model relates to a photovoltaic stringer is with portable welding set, including two backup pads 1 that are vertical form setting, be provided with a moving mechanism 2 between two backup pads 1 jointly, wherein fixed mounting has a actuating mechanism 3 on one side lateral wall of a backup pad 1, is provided with a welding supporting mechanism 4 on the moving mechanism 2 that is located between two backup pads 1, is provided with a supporting mechanism 5 between two backup pads 1 that are located under moving mechanism 2 position.
The moving mechanism 2 comprises a screw rod 21, two ends of the screw rod 21 rotate between the side walls of the opposite sides of the two support plates 1 through bearings respectively, one end of the screw rod 21 penetrates through the corresponding support plate 1 and extends outwards, and a screw rod nut 22 is connected to the rod wall of the screw rod 21 between the two support plates 1 in a threaded manner.
The driving mechanism 3 comprises a driving motor 31, the driving motor 31 is fixedly connected to one side wall of one of the supporting plates 1, the output end of the driving motor 31 is fixedly connected with a first bevel gear 32 through a coupler, a second bevel gear 33 is fixedly sleeved on the rod wall of the screw rod 21 positioned outside the two supporting plates 1, and the first bevel gear 32 is meshed with the second bevel gear 33.
The welding support mechanism 4 includes a support base 41, the support base 41 is fixedly connected to the outer side wall of the feed screw nut 22, and a welding machine 42 is fixedly connected to the lower surface of the support base 41.
Wherein, supporting mechanism 5 includes a bracing piece 51 that is the rectangle setting, bracing piece 51 fixed connection is between two backup pad 1 lateral walls in opposite directions that are located the lead screw 21 below position, it has seted up a through-hole 52 to run through on the supporting seat 41 that corresponds the bracing piece 51 position, bracing piece 51 is the setting of through-hole 52, a sliding tray 53 has been seted up to bracing piece 51's upper surface, correspond two sets of connecting blocks 54 of fixedly connected with on the position of sliding tray 53 on the upper end pore wall of through-hole 52, the lower extreme of two sets of connecting blocks 54 all runs through the notch of sliding tray 53 and extends to in the sliding tray 53, every connecting block 54 of group all includes two connecting blocks 54 that are the paralleling setting, all be connected with a gyro wheel 55 through the pivot rotation between the lateral wall in opposite directions that two connecting blocks 54 of every group are located sliding tray 53, the.
Wherein, the screw rod 21 and the support rod 51 are arranged in parallel in the horizontal direction.
Specifically, the utility model relates to a photovoltaic stringer is with portable welding set, when using, at first start driving motor 31, driving motor 31 drives lead screw 21 through the meshing of first bevel gear 32 and second bevel gear 33 and rotates, simultaneously supporting seat 41 and screw-nut 22 can't rotate under the cooperation of bracing piece 51 with through-hole 52, make lead screw 21 lead screw nut 22 can drive supporting seat 41 and remove when rotating, gyro wheel 55 supports supporting seat 41 through connecting block 54 simultaneously, and gyro wheel 55 slides at the tank bottom of sliding tray 53 and comes the removal of auxiliary support seat 41 with welding machine 42, welding machine 42 has been reduced and the resistance when carrying out the steady removal, the regulation of welding machine 42 position of being convenient for.
